Abstract 1159: Downregulation of TMPRSS11B in squamous cell carcinoma

2016 
[Background] Esophageal squamous cell carcinoma (ESCC) is one of the most malignant cancers. The molecular mechanism of ESCC development has not been fully elucidated. [Aim] The aim of this study is to identify responsible genes for ESCC development. [Materials and Methods] Firstly, we performed transcriptome sequence (RNA-seq) analysis of surgically resected tumor and corresponding normal tissues form 3 ESCC patients with different tumor locus, histrogical differentiation, and TNM stage.by RNA-seq analysis: (Case 1) upper thoracic esophagus, well differentiated SCC, TNM, Stage I; (Case 2) middle thoracic esophagus, poorly differentiated SCC, T3N0M0, Stage II; and (Case 3) lower thoracic esophagus, moderately differentiated SCC, T3N1M0, Stage III. Next, we validated the expression status of the candidate gene in 64 clinical samples and 10 ESCC cell lines (KYSE150, KYSE270, KYSE410, KYSE450, KYSE510, TE1, TE6, TE8, TE9, and TE10) using quantitative real-time PCR (qRT-PCR). [Results] In RNA-seq analysis, 34 genes showed more than 30-fold decrease in tumor samples compared to normal tissues, and the most downregulated gene was transmembrane protease serine 11B (TMPRSS11B).
